Choosing the Right CNC Bearing Suppliers: Factors to Consider and the Importance of Quality Partners

Introduction

CNC (Computer Numerical Control) machines play a critical role in modern manufacturing processes, offering high levels of precision, accuracy, and efficiency. Bearings are essential components for the performance and reliability of these machines, making the choice of bearing suppliers a crucial factor in ensuring optimal productivity and minimizing equipment downtime. In this article, we will discuss the factors to consider when selecting CNC bearing suppliers and the importance of building quality partnerships with them.

Factors to Consider When Choosing CNC Bearing Suppliers

Product Quality: The quality of the bearings supplied directly impacts the performance, reliability, and life expectancy of CNC machines. When selecting a bearing supplier, ensure they have a proven track record of providing high-quality products that meet or exceed industry standards.

Product Range: A wide range of bearing types, sizes, and materials may be required for different CNC applications. Choose a supplier that offers a comprehensive product portfolio, ensuring they can meet your specific needs and requirements.

Technical Expertise: The bearing supplier should have a deep understanding of bearing technology, CNC applications, and industry trends. This expertise is crucial in providing valuable guidance and support in selecting the right bearings and optimizing machine performance.

Customer Support: A reliable supplier should offer excellent customer service, including pre-sales consultation, product selection assistance, and after-sales support, such as technical troubleshooting and warranty claims.

Availability and Lead Time: Ensure that the bearing supplier can provide the required products within an acceptable lead time, minimizing the risk of machine downtime due to bearing unavailability.

Pricing: While pricing is undoubtedly an essential factor, it should not be the sole criterion when selecting a bearing supplier. Consider the overall value offered by the supplier, including product quality, technical expertise, customer support, and delivery times.

The Importance of Quality Partnerships with CNC Bearing Suppliers

Improved Machine Performance: By partnering with a reliable bearing supplier, manufacturers can ensure their CNC machines are equipped with high-quality bearings, resulting in improved machine performance, increased productivity, and reduced maintenance costs.

Access to Expertise: A quality partnership with a bearing supplier provides access to their technical expertise, helping manufacturers make informed decisions regarding bearing selection, installation, and maintenance.

Faster Problem Resolution: In case of bearing-related issues, a strong partnership with the supplier can lead to faster problem resolution, minimizing machine downtime and production losses.

Continuous Improvement: A long-term partnership with a bearing supplier can facilitate continuous improvement in bearing performance, as both parties work together to identify areas of potential improvement and implement solutions.

Cost Savings: A quality partnership can lead to cost savings over time, as the bearing supplier may offer volume discounts, better pricing for long-term customers, or assistance in optimizing bearing selection and maintenance to reduce overall costs.
